philodendria Leafy Shirred Cowl
This shirred cowl or scarf is so elegant and versatile, you can even wear it as a hood, and with less than one (125 yd) skein of chunky yarn knits up in no time!
Stitches used: K, P, K2TOG, K3TOG, SSK, SK2P, YO
Supplies needed: US sz 13 needles
2 or more 3/4” + buttons (optional, you can use only the drawstring if you like/or just button(s) and no drawstring)
tapestry neeedle
2 yard of ribbon, or crochet a chain from the leftover yarn (optional pom poms)
Yarn: 1 skein of bulky yarn (from the thicker end of the bulky designation) I recommend Lambs Pride bulky.
Directions are both charted and written
